Microsoft Game Studios announced today that the
eagerly-awaited “Gears of War” for Windows (Windows XP/Windows Vista) has
shipped to retailers worldwide and will be in stores this week. After launching
exclusively for the Xbox 360 last November, “Gears of War” is now bringing the
fight to Windows, featuring five new campaigns, new multiplayer modes and full
Games for Windows – LIVE support for online multiplayer gameplay sessions.
With the Xbox 360 version of the game selling more than 4 million copies to
date, “Gears of War” has been lauded by critics for its gripping campaign and
fast-paced multiplayer action. Windows gamers can look forward to the “Gears of
War” experience for the very first time, and will get to choose between doing
battle via mouse and keyboard, or using the Windows-enabled Xbox 360 controller.
From renowned developer Epic Games, “Gears of War” for Windows will engage
gamers in hyper-realistic combat, allowing players to fight for survival against
the Locust Horde, a nightmarish race of creatures that surface from the bowels
of the planet.
In addition to retaining all of the content from its Xbox 360 counterpart and
all previously released downloadable content (seven multiplayer maps and the
Annex game mode), “Gears of War” for Windows will feature exciting original
content, all-new Achievements to unlock and ultra-high resolution visuals,
including support for DirectX 10. Five new campaign chapters expand upon the
riveting story (including an epic battle with the fearsome Brumak), and the
action-packed multiplayer offering is bolstered with three exclusive multiplayer
maps, a “King of the Hill” game type and Games for Windows – LIVE support to
deliver online matchmaking for LIVE members. A new game editor will allow users
to develop an unlimited number of user-created levels with complete access to
the Unreal® Engine 3 Editor.
